The work "Electroquímica Moderna" by John O'Morrow Bockris and Amulya K. N. Reddy is a foundational text that redefined electrochemistry from a niche sub-discipline of physical chemistry into a broad, interdisciplinary field. First published in 1970 and later expanded into a second edition in 1998, this work is widely regarded as the definitive "bible" for researchers and students alike. The primary aim of Bockris and Reddy was to create a comprehensive resource accessible to individuals with varied scientific backgrounds—including physics, biology, metallurgy, and materials science. The work is typically divided into several key volumes that categorize the subject into two main areas: Ionics and Electrodics. Volume 1: Ionics
- Core Topics: The nature of ions in solution, ion-solvent interactions, ionic equilibria, transport phenomena (diffusion, migration, convection), and the structure of the electrical double layer.
- Key Concepts: Born model of ion solvation, Debye–Hückel theory (including limitations), Wien effect, and the thermodynamics of electrolyte solutions.
- Applications: Water desalination, biological membrane potentials, and concentrated solutions.
John O'M. Bockris, an Australian-born electrochemist, made significant contributions to the field of electrochemistry, particularly in the areas of electrode kinetics, electrochemical energy conversion, and surface electrochemistry. His work, which spanned over five decades, focused on understanding the fundamental principles governing electrochemical reactions.
